Job summary

A prestigious research institution is seeking a researcher in planetary science to conduct experiments on Titan and develop advanced probes for in-situ characterization. The role requires a doctoral degree in a relevant field and experience in spectroscopy or experimental physical chemistry. Candidates should have a strong research publication track record. This position offers competitive fellowships and access to advanced instrumentation.

Qualifications

  • Experience in spectroscopy, ultrahigh vacuum techniques, and/or experimental physical chemistry.
  • Strong record of research publications relevant to Titan or planetary science.

Responsibilities

  • Conduct experiments to examine solubility, precipitation, photochemistry, and low‐temperature thermal reactions of organic molecules.
  • Develop and test ultraviolet and infrared fiber optic probes for in‐situ characterization.
  • Analyze data and contribute to publications on Titan and related planetary science.

Education

Doctoral degree in Chemistry, Physics, Geology, Planetary Science, or related field
